4. Protection of unreleased apps

The confidentiality of your app is ensured by the Google Play closed testing model itself:

  • The app stays on a private track, invisible in the public store — it does not appear in searches and cannot be found or downloaded by anyone who is not authorized;
  • Access is restricted to the Google accounts added as testers, always through Google Play's own private channel;
  • Testers do not receive the APK or the source code — only controlled access to the app during the test cycle;
  • When the test ends, access is closed.
